Late-night television took a sharp political turn this week as Jimmy Kimmel Live! host Jimmy Kimmel took aim at President Donald Trump’s latest round of cabinet selections. With his signature mix of humor and critique, Kimmel accused the president of “running the country like a reality show,” saying Trump’s choices feel more like casting decisions than serious appointments.
Comedy Meets Commentary
Kimmel, who has never shied away from mixing politics into his monologue, delivered the remarks during a recent broadcast that quickly went viral. “At this point, Trump’s Cabinet isn’t a team—it’s a reality TV reunion special,” Kimmel joked. “All that’s missing is a rose ceremony.”
The late-night host went on to describe recent cabinet changes as “dramatic,” “chaotic,” and “deeply unserious,” comparing the process to shows like The Apprentice—the very series that helped launch Trump into mainstream celebrity years before his political career.
Cabinet Choices Under Fire
Kimmel’s comments come amid renewed scrutiny over President Trump’s latest picks for top government posts. Critics argue that some selections lack traditional experience in public service or relevant fields. Supporters, however, say Trump is bringing in fresh, outsider perspectives—just as he promised during his first campaign and again during his second term.
Among the most talked-about appointments:
- A former television commentator tapped for Secretary of Education
- A high-profile business executive named to lead the Department of Health and Human Services
- A retired general returning to a key defense advisory role
While these choices have raised eyebrows among political analysts and media personalities like Kimmel, many conservatives see them as consistent with Trump’s ongoing effort to shake up the “Washington swamp.”
